Transaction 12024745c256103207f75ca39d3d72438acf3cd8d457639c4dfdec720ca277ca

2 Input
2 Outputs
  • 12024745c256103207f75ca39d3d72438acf3cd8d457639c4dfdec720ca277ca:0
  • value  2851353
    address  1Dvv8GU4hSMpPcyBeiQYafWKH3EvrE8QNT
  • 12024745c256103207f75ca39d3d72438acf3cd8d457639c4dfdec720ca277ca:1
  • value  815171
    address  13KEkRvnXydA27sbZmZFf15Mn6okvrff3o